NSW Bill to change 55 Acts now passes the House

NSW Bill to change 55 Acts now passes the House

The New South Wales bill, which I have posted about before, and had previously passed with amendments in the NSW Upper House, and which will alter 55 pieces of legislation, including allowing lesbian co-parents to be recognised on the birth certificate, has now passed the lower house and been sent back to the Upper House for consent.
